Making It Work: Practical Guidance for Your Projects
Choosing to use a creative font or texture like this is a design decision that impacts several facets of your project. Here’s how to approach it thoughtfully.
- Evaluate Project Fit: Ask yourself: What is the core emotion or message? Yellow glitter communicates celebration, optimism, and warmth. It's a natural fit for events, children's products, beauty brands, and food-related designs. It might be less suitable for corporate law firms or ultra-minimalist tech startups. Always align the asset's personality with your project's goals.
- Consider Readability & Hierarchy: Glitter is a busy texture. To maintain professionalism, your typography must work with it, not against it. Use bold, high-contrast typefaces. Avoid overly delicate script fonts or thin handwritten fonts for body text, as they can get lost. Instead, use them as accents. Ensure there is sufficient contrast between your text color and the background. Often, placing text on a solid-colored shape (a banner, a circle, a rectangle) that sits on top of the glitter background is the most effective and readable solution.
- Test Font Pairings: If you're building a full design, think about font pairing. A strong, geometric sans serif for headlines paired with a classic, readable serif for body copy can create a beautiful balance against a textured background. The glitter provides the visual interest, while the fonts deliver the information cleanly.
